Join us at razorfish.com. **Overview** As a copywriter, you will be responsible for crafting compelling written content—such as headlines, taglines, and scripts—while partnering with an art director to develop cohesive, persuasive campaigns that effectively align with brand strategy and effectively communicate the intended message, engaging the target audience. This is a hybrid role, requiring three days in-office each week. If you are contacted for an interview, your recruiter will discuss specifics with you, inclusive of any necessary reasonable accommodations. **Responsibilities** + Write clear, engaging, and persuasive copy for various media (digital, print, TV, radio, social, etc.). + Collaborate closely with art directors to execute integrated advertising campaigns. + Develop headlines, taglines, scripts, and body copy that match the brand voice and campaign goals. + Participate in brainstorming sessions and contribute original ideas + Adapt tone and messaging to suit different audiences and platforms + Revise and refine copy based on internal and client feedback + Stay informed on industry trends, consumer insights, and competitor messaging + Ensure all copy is accurate, on-brand, and delivered on deadline + Maintain up-to-date knowledge of client’s products and services **Qualifications** + Bachelor’s Degree or higher in advertising, marketing, communications, journalism, English, or a related field. + Strong writing and editing skills, with a portfolio showcasing creative and persuasive work. + Understanding branding, marketing strategy, and consumer behavior + Collaborate effectively with art directors, strategists, and clients. + Experience with multiple media formats, including digital, print, video, and social media. + Time management and adaptability to meet tight deadlines in a fast-paced environment + Creative thinking and problem-solving skills + Proficiency with creative tools (e.g., Adobe Creative Suite, Figma) a plus. + General awareness and understanding of the digital landscape, including online campaigns, mobile experiences, and social media landscape. + Enthusiasm, big ideas and attention for details. + ***Please provide portfolio link and resume when applying*** **Additional information** The Power of One starts with our people!
